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y is the 148th most popular major in the country with 5,275 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.
Across Indiana, there were 65 med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 54 med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ist graduates with average earnings and debt of $39,620 and $24,786 respectively.

Top 4 Best Value Bachelor’s Degree Colleges for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y (Income $0-$30k) in Indiana
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Indiana University - Northwest.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ist Schools for a Bachelor’s in Indiana For Those Making $0-$30k list. Indiana University - Northwest is located in Gary, Indiana and, has a small student population. In 2019-2020, this school awarded 3 bachelors’s med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ist degrees to qualified students.
IU Northwest also made our “Best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Indiana” list, coming in at #2. It costs about $3,287 for indiana bachelor’s degree med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end IU Northwest.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Indiana University - Purdue University - Indianapolis. It ranked #2 on our 2022 Best Value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ist Schools for a Bachelor’s in Indiana For Those Making $0-$30k list. Located in Indianapolis, Indiana, this large public school handed out 27 degrees to qualified bachelors’s med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ist students in 2019-2020.
IUPUI also made our “Best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Indiana” list, coming in at #1. The yearly cost to attend Indiana University - Purdue University - Indianapolis is $5,052 for Indiana Bachelor’s Degree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ist students whose families make $0-$30k.
Out of the 4 schools in the Best Value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ist Schools for a Bachelor’s in Indiana For Those Making $0-$30k that were part of this year’s ranking, Indiana University - South Bend landed the #3 spot on the list. Indiana University - South Bend is a small school located in South Bend, Indiana that handed out 13 bachelors’s med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ist degrees in 2019-2020.
Indiana University - South Bend did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#3 on our “Best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Indiana” list. It costs about $4,641 for Indiana Bachelor’s Degree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end Indiana University - South Bend.
Out of the 4 schools in the Best Value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ist Schools for a Bachelor’s in Indiana For Those Making $0-$30k that were part of this year’s ranking, Indiana University - Kokomo landed the #4 spot on the list. Indiana University - Kokomo is a small school located in Kokomo, Indiana that handed out 10 bachelors’s medical radiologic technology/science - radiation therapist degrees in 2019-2020.
IU Kokomo did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#4 on our “Best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apy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Indiana” list. It costs about $4,360 for Indiana Bachelor’s Degree Medical Radiologic Technology/Science - Radiation Therapist students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end IU Kokomo.
